SEOUL: North Korean leader Kim Jong-Un hailed a submarine-launched ballistic missile test as an “eye-opening success”, state media said Sunday, declaring Pyongyang has the ability to strike Seoul and the US whenever it pleases.

The US, joined by Britain, said Saturday’s apparent test was a violation of UN Security Council resolutions and called on the North to refrain from further moves that could destabilise the region, APP reported.

South Korea’s defence ministry said the launch appeared to have failed as the missile, fired from a submarine in the Sea of Japan, flew just 30 kilometres (18 miles).

However the North’s state-run KCNA news agency insisted that the test, which it said was personally monitored by Kim, confirmed “the reliability of the Korean-style underwater launching system”.

It cited the young leader as saying that Pyongyang “is now capable of hitting the heads of the South Korean puppet forces and the US imperialists anytime as it pleases.”

“This eye-opening success constitutes one more precious gift the defence scientists and technicians are presenting to the great leaders and the party,” it added.
